본문 바로가기
반응형

Linux19

[ubutntu] tomcat9 설치, 에러 해결 오류 발생/usr/libexec/tomcat9/tomcat-start.sh: 25: exec: /usr/share/tomcat9/bin/catalina.sh: not found톰캣 디렉토리, 파일들 지우고 덮어쓰고 하다가 에러가 발생했습니다    tomcat 패키지 설치패키지 삭제sudo apt-get purge tomcat9 tomcat9-adminpurge 명령어로 패키지와 함께 설정파일도 함께 삭제합니다 sudo apt-get autoremove의존성 때문에 설치된 패키지도 삭제합니다이 명령어 후 재 설치했을 때 오류가 해결됐습니다 패키지 설치sudo apt-get install tomcat9 tomcat9-admin다시 패키지를 설치합니다추가 작업tomcat 관리자 추가sudo vi /etc/to.. 2024. 8. 13.
[Docker] DockerFile 빌드 설치 및 설정 https://www.docker.com/products/docker-desktop/ Docker Desktop: The #1 Containerization Tool for Developers | DockerDocker Desktop is collaborative containerization software for developers. Get started and download Docker Desktop today on Mac, Windows, or Linux.www.docker.comdocker desktop을 설치하고 실행했더니 가상화 활성화하라고 오류 발생했습니다.  https://m.blog.naver.com/kkm082/222678613898 AMD 라이젠 가상화(SVM) 설정.. 2024. 8. 13.
Ubuntu ssh 외부 접속과 포트포워딩 환경Ubuntu 서버를 하나 생성했습니다 Port를 따로 설정하지 않으면 22번이니 기본 설정으로 진행했습니다 Ubuntu 서버의 IP는 123.34.6.78연결된 인터넷의 IP는 222.333.444.55 로 가정했습니다    SSH 연결ssh -p @위 명령어로 간단하게 cmd에서 연결 확인해보겠습니다22번 포트가 아니라면 -p 옵션으로 포트를 지정해야 합니다 ssh user@123.45.6.78 # 22번 포트면 -p 생략 가능같은 인터넷 망에서 Ubuntu 서버에 접근할 때는해당 IP 주소를 입력하면 접근할 수 있습니다  외부 SSH 연결외부에서 접근할 수 있게 포트 포워딩을 합니다  ssh user@123.45.6.78 # 22번 포트면 -p 생략 가능문제는 외부에서 SSH로 접속할 때는 해당.. 2024. 8. 9.
[Linux] 사용자와 그룹 관리 사용자 제어 명령어 useradd - 사용자 추가 [root@localhost ~] man useradd# 옵션 확인 [root@localhost ~] useradd -u 1234 newuser2# id 지정 [root@localhost ~] useradd -g newGroup newuser3# 그룹 지정 [root@localhost ~] useradd -d /newHome newUser4# 홈 디렉토리 지정 [root@localhost ~] useradd -s /bin/csh nweUser5# 쉘 지정 쉘은 설정하지 않으면 기본으로 /bin/bash 로 되어있습니다. passwd - 사용자 비밀번호 변경 [root@localhost ~] passwd# root 비밀번호 변경 [root@localhost.. 2024. 3. 23.
MariaDB Timezone 변경 Timezone 확인SELECT @@global.time_zone, @@session.time_zone,@@system_time_zone; 현재 설정되어있는 시간대를 확인해 봅니다.   @@global.time_zone@@session.time_zon@@system_time_zoneSYSTEMSYSTEMUTC다음과 같이 SYSTEM으로 출력되면 UTC시간 그대로 사용하기 때문에한국시간보다 9시간 느린 시각으로 작동합니다.     SELECT now() now()를 확인해보면 한국시간 기준으로 17시인데, 8시로 나오는 걸 확인할 수 있습니다.  SQL로 Timezone 변경SET global TIME_ZONE='+09:00';SET session TIME_ZONE='+09:00';SELECT @@glob.. 2023. 4. 14.
PHP 업로드 용량 수정 용량 설정 확인 phpinfo.php페이지에서 업로드 용량 설정을 확인합니다. 설정된 용량때문에 업로드가 안되는게 맞다면 php.ini를 수정해야합니다. find / -name php.ini -print php.ini를 찾을 수 없다면 위 명령어를 입력해 php.ini의 위치를 찾습니다 (권한 문제가 있으면 앞에 sudo를 작성 후 입력해줍니다) 업로드 용량 재설정 vi /etc/php.ini 저는 /etc/php.ini 디렉터리에 있어서 vi 에디터로 php.ini파일을 엽니다 upload_max_filesize = 100M # 파일 최대 업로드 용량 post_max_size = 200M # POST요청을 통한 업로드 용량 - upload_max_filesize 보다 크게? memory_limit = .. 2023. 1. 25.
반응형